Now, all your employees and managers outside of accounting need is visibility to spending, so they can collaborate more on purchasing and contract decisions.Bridging the Divide Between Accounts Payable & ProcurementSurprisingly, 33% of organizations reported in a PayStream Advisors survey of over 200 back-office professionals that their accounts payable and purchasing systems were still totally separate ("2016 P2P for Indirect Spend Report," 4). Imagine that your procurement team has just spent a few weeks renegotiating a vendor contract with new pricing. Then, they file away the contract. When a department manager receives an invoice from that same vendor, alas, the manager has no way to view the invoice against the contract budget.Why is it so important that we bring together these two processes? It gives our CFO and CEO a lot of comfort knowing that we are tracking POs on a regular basis."Gaining a Holistic View of SpendingAn Integrated cloud purchase to payment solution that extends your accounting software brings visibility to spending full circle. With an end-to-end solution, the department manager can view the invoice applied against the contract budget during approval. In addition, if the invoice is associated with a purchase order, the manager can drill back to the associated PO receipt, PO and requisition. A few of our managers approve everything out of the office."Pre-Approving Purchases to Control CostsA unified requisition to PO to invoice process also helps organizations to take control over spending before it actually occurs. For instance, the CFO can view large IT requisition requests against the budget and decide to buy now or buy later in another budget period. Managers can check on the budget for an internal project with multiple vendors, such as a build-out, to help them make better spending decisions. Reducing Costs and Saving TimeBy implementing an automated AP and procurement solution, you also eliminate re-keying of data between disparate systems.
